什么是程序設(shè)計分析技術(shù)當代社會,計算機科學已經(jīng)滲透到各個領(lǐng)域,而程序設(shè)計作為計算機科學的一個重要分支,被廣泛應用于軟件開發(fā)、系統(tǒng)設(shè)計和數(shù)據(jù)分析等領(lǐng)域。而程序設(shè)計分析技術(shù)作為程序設(shè)計的基礎(chǔ),扮演著非常重要的角色。
程序設(shè)計分析技術(shù)是指在進行程序設(shè)計之前,對需求進行全面準確的分析,從而找出問題所在,并提出相應解決方案的過程。這種技術(shù)通過細致入微的分析,有助于為軟件開發(fā)團隊提供準確的需求指導,提高項目的成功率,減少在后期開發(fā)過程中產(chǎn)生的問題和成本。
首先,程序設(shè)計分析技術(shù)能夠幫助確定需求。在軟件開發(fā)過程中,需求分析是至關(guān)重要的一步。通過程序設(shè)計分析技術(shù),我們可以詳細地了解用戶的需求和期望,澄清開發(fā)中的模糊點,從而確保最終產(chǎn)品符合用戶需求。這能夠避免需求誤解和滿足用戶的真實期望,提高用戶滿意度。
其次,程序設(shè)計分析技術(shù)能夠幫助識別潛在問題。在需求分析的過程中,我們不僅需要考慮用戶的實際需求,還需要思考可能存在的問題和障礙。通過程序設(shè)計分析技術(shù),我們可以對需求進行深入挖掘,并提前識別可能遇到的問題,從而提出解決方案。這種預先識別問題的能力可以大大減少項目的失敗風險,提高項目的成功率。
另外,程序設(shè)計分析技術(shù)能夠優(yōu)化系統(tǒng)設(shè)計。在軟件開發(fā)過程中,系統(tǒng)設(shè)計是一個復雜的過程,需要從多個方面進行綜合考慮。通過程序設(shè)計分析技術(shù),我們可以分析系統(tǒng)的不同組成部分,了解它們之間的關(guān)系和依賴,從而進行合理的系統(tǒng)設(shè)計。這種技術(shù)可以提高系統(tǒng)的可靠性、可維護性和可擴展性,使系統(tǒng)更加穩(wěn)定和高效運行。
此外,程序設(shè)計分析技術(shù)還能夠提高代碼質(zhì)量。在程序開發(fā)過程中,良好的分析技術(shù)可以幫助我們更好地掌握代碼的結(jié)構(gòu)和邏輯。通過深入分析和評估程序的各個方面,我們可以及時發(fā)現(xiàn)和修正潛在的問題,提高代碼的可讀性和可維護性。這對于團隊合作開發(fā)和后續(xù)維護非常重要,能夠提高開發(fā)效率和減少后期維護成本。
最后,程序設(shè)計分析技術(shù)對于數(shù)據(jù)分析也有著重要的作用。在當前的大數(shù)據(jù)時代,數(shù)據(jù)分析在各個行業(yè)扮演著舉足輕重的角色。通過程序設(shè)計分析技術(shù),我們可以針對特定需求收集和處理數(shù)據(jù),提取有價值的信息,并進行有效的數(shù)據(jù)分析和挖掘。這種技術(shù)能夠幫助企業(yè)做出更準確的決策,提高業(yè)務(wù)效率和競爭力。
綜上所述,程序設(shè)計分析技術(shù)在計算機科學領(lǐng)域中具有重要地位和作用。它能夠幫助確定需求、識別潛在問題、優(yōu)化系統(tǒng)設(shè)計、提高代碼質(zhì)量和支持數(shù)據(jù)分析。通過合理運用程序設(shè)計分析技術(shù),我們可以提高軟件開發(fā)的成功率和效率,從而為我們的生活和工作提供更多便利和創(chuàng)新。